Johann Christian Luther
Summary
Johann Christian Luther is a human[1]. His place of birth was Tallinn[2]. He was born on +1804-06-01T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Tallinn[4]. He died on +1853-07-28T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a cleric[6].

Education
Educated at Gustav Adolf Grammar School[9], a general education school[23], in Estonia[24], founded in 1631[25], headquartered in Tallinn[26] and Imperial University of Dorpat[10], an imperial universities of the Russian Empire[27], in Russian Empire[28], founded in 1803[29], headquartered in Tartu[30].
